Tag: visual studio

CMakeLists.txt CMake错误:30(项目):找不到CMAKE_C_COMPILER

我想与Cmake的Visual Studio解决scheme编译的最新版本的aseprite和cmake不断给我: No CMAKE_C_COMPILER could be found. No CMAKE_CXX_COMPILER could be found. 我已经下载了gcc,我正在使用visual studio 2015。 我正在关注这个教程/ https://github.com/aseprite/aseprite/blob/master/INSTALL.md 我一直在寻找大约3个小时,并没有在互联网上的解决scheme。

如何在Visual Studio中的项目/解决scheme之间共享代码?

我有两个解决scheme,有一些共同的代码,所以我想提取出来,并在他们之间分享。 此外,我希望能够独立发布该图书馆,因为这可能对其他人有用。 用Visual Studio 2008做什么最好的方法是什么? 一个项目是否存在多个解决scheme? 我是否有独立的代码解决scheme? 一个解决scheme可以依赖于另一个吗?

Visual Studio项目和解决scheme的.gitignore

将Git与Visual Studio Solutions( .sln )和Projects结合使用时,应将哪些文件包含在.gitignore ?

Microsoft.ACE.OLEDB.12.0提供程序未注册

我有一个Visual Studio 2008解决scheme与两个项目(Word模板项目和VB.Net控制台应用程序进行testing)。 两个项目都引用了一个数据库项目,该项目打开一个到MS-Access 2007数据库文件的连接,并具有对System.Data.OleDb的引用。 在数据库项目中,我有一个函数,如下所示检索数据表 private class AdminDatabase ' stores the connection string which is set in the New() method dim strAdminConnection as string public sub New() … adminName = dlgopen.FileName conAdminDB = New OleDbConnection conAdminDB.ConnectionString = "Data Source='" + adminName + "';" + _ "Provider=Microsoft.ACE.OLEDB.12.0" ' store the connection string in strAdminConnection strAdminConnection […]

静态variables初始化顺序

C ++保证编译单元(.cpp文件)中的variables按照声明的顺序进行初始化。 对于编译单元的数量,这个规则分别适用于每一个(我是指类之外的静态variables)。 但是,variables初始化的顺序在不同的编译单元中是不确定的。 我在哪里可以看到关于gcc和MSVC的这个命令的一些解释(我知道依靠这是一个非常糟糕的主意 – 这只是为了理解我们在移植到新的GCC主要和不同的操作系统时可能会遇到的问题) ?

C99 stdint.h头文件和MS Visual Studio

令我惊奇的是,我发现C99 stdint.h从MS Visual Studio 2003中向上丢失了。 我相信他们有他们的理由,但有谁知道我可以在哪里下载副本? 没有这个头文件,我没有定义有用的types,如uint32_t等

如何在Visual Studio 2013中启用C#6.0function?

我正在浏览在C#6.0中引入的最新function,并且只是以自动属性初始值设定项为例, class NewSample { public Guid Id { get; } = Guid.NewGuid(); } 但是我的IDE没有识别这个语法。 我想知道如何在Visual Studio 2013中启用C#6.0。我使用的目标框架是4.5.1。

在开发和生产环境中使用不同的Web.config

我需要在ASP.NET应用程序中使用不同的数据库连接string和SMTP服务器地址,具体取决于它是在开发环境还是在生产环境中运行。 该应用程序通过WebConfigurationManager.AppSettings属性从Web.config文件读取设置。 我使用Build / Publish命令通过FTP将应用程序部署到生产服务器,然后用正确的手动replace远程Web.config。 有没有可能简化部署的过程? 谢谢!

Visual Studio 2010总是认为项目已经过时,但没有任何改变

我有一个非常类似的问题在这里描述。 我还将C ++ / CLI和C#项目的混合解决scheme从Visual Studio 2008升级到Visual Studio 2010.现在,在Visual Studio 2010中,一个C ++ / CLI项目总是运行过期。 即使在F5被打开之前已经被编译和链接了,消息框“The project is outd date,you want to build it?” 出现。 这是非常烦人的,因为DLL文件是非常低的层次,并迫使解决scheme的几乎所有项目重build。 我的pdb设置被设置为默认值( 这个问题的build议解决scheme )。 是否有可能得到为什么Visual Studio 2010强制重build或认为项目是最新的原因? 任何其他的想法,为什么Visual Studio 2010的行为呢?

如果在解决scheme中使用项目依赖关系,MSBuild不会复制引用(DLL文件)

我有我的Visual Studio解决scheme中的四个项目(每个人都针对.NET 3.5) – 对于我的问题,只有这两个是重要的: MyBaseProject < – 这个类库引用第三方DLL文件(elmah.dll) MyWebProject1 < – 此Web应用程序项目具有对MyBaseProject的引用 我通过点击“添加引用…”→“浏览”选项卡→select“elmah.dll”,在Visual Studio 2008中添加了elmah.dll引用到MyBaseProject 。 Elmah参考的属性如下: 别名 – 全球 复制本地 – 真实 文化 – 说明 – 错误logging模块和处理程序(ELMAH)for ASP.NET 文件types – 组装 path – D:\ webs \ otherfolder \ _myPath \ __ tools \ elmah \ Elmah.dll 解决 – 真的 运行时版本 – v2.0.50727 指定的版本 […]